How can one remove an ant scent trail without bug spray?

I spilled some grease in the sink that I didn’t wash down. The ants found the spot. Now there’s a trail of ants. I don’t want to spray poison in my kitchen. I know ants follow a trail and that cleaners like windex and sparkle don’t remove the scent trail.
